Tragic accident in Lisbon claims life of third British tourist with a passion for transportation systems.
In the heart of Lisbon, Portugal's capital, a tragic incident occurred on a historic funicular, known as the Gloria. On the fateful day, the funicular, which is 140 years old and features two separate yellow carriages connected by steel cables, came off the rails, resulting in a devastating crash.
Among the 16 lives lost were Andrew David Kenneth Young, a 82-year-old Briton, fondly known as Dave, who had a long career as a customs officer and was a lifelong transport enthusiast. He enjoyed visiting heritage railways and tramways around the world. Also among the deceased were five Portuguese nationals, two Canadians, two South Koreans, one American, one French, one Swiss, one Ukrainian, theatre director Kayleigh Smith, and her partner Will Nelson, who were two other Britons on board.
The derailment led to one of the carriages crashing into a building at a bend in the road. The cabin's brakeman applied the pneumatic brake and hand brake, but to no avail, as the cabin continued to accelerate down the slope. The connecting cable between Cabin No. 1 and the top of the hill gave way, causing Cabin No. 2 to suddenly reverse and halt approximately 10 meters beyond the end of the track. The underside of Cabin No. 2 was buried at the end of the cable trench.
The likely cause of the crash was an issue with the cable that connected the streetcar's two cabins. A preliminary and final report are expected to be published later.
The incident left 21 people injured, including five seriously. The driver or technical person responsible on the day of the accident was Andres Marques, who had been the brake operator on the funicular for 15 years.
